Whether $45,000 a year is a good salary depends on various factors such as location, living expenses, personal lifestyle, and financial obligations. In some areas, this amount can comfortably cover basic needs and offer some discretionary spending, while in high-cost living areas, it might stretch the budget thin. Budgeting and financial planning are key to making the most out of this salary, focusing on saving, investing, and controlling expenses.

  1. What factors determine if $45,000 is a good salary? Key factors include your location, living expenses, personal lifestyle choices, and any financial obligations you may have. In some regions, $45,000 can provide a comfortable living, while in others, it may not be sufficient.
  2. How can I make the most of a $45,000 salary? Effective budgeting, financial planning, prioritizing savings, and controlled spending are crucial to managing a $45,000 salary. Focus on necessities first and look for areas where you can cut costs.
  3. Is $45,000 a livable wage in high-cost cities? In high-cost living areas, $45,000 may not cover all necessary expenses, making it challenging to maintain a comfortable lifestyle. It's important to assess local cost of living and adjust your budget accordingly.
  4. What should I consider when evaluating my salary? Consider your current and future financial goals, lifestyle needs, job market trends in your area, and whether your salary allows you to save and invest for the future.
